Title: The Innovative Contributions of Alain Peigney

Introduction

Alain Peigney, an accomplished inventor based in S'Loup de Varennes, France, has made significant strides in the field of heterogeneous welding. With a total of three patents to his name, his innovative methods focus on improving the efficiency and effectiveness of joining different materials.

Latest Patents

Among his latest inventions, Peigney holds a patent for a "Method for joining two parts of different kinds by heterogeneous butt welding, and uses thereof." This inventive method outlines that the end portions of two parts are machined to create a welding bevel, which facilitates the deposition of filler metal into the bevel. Notably, the welding bevel is designed to have a narrow structure with side walls forming an aperture angle of no more than 5° relative to the longitudinal central plane. Peigney's work utilizes a nickel alloy containing 18-32% chromium, proving particularly effective for joining pressurized water nuclear reactor vessel tubing and austenitic stainless steel primary circuit pipes.

Another significant patent is the "Method for joining two parts by heterogeneous welding and use thereof," which further underscores his expertise in this specialized area.
